The Significance of Surya Grahan in Indian Culture

Solar eclipses have been documented in Indian texts dating back thousands of years, with references in ancient texts like the Rigveda and the Mahabharata. In Hindu mythology, a solar eclipse is often seen as a time of great significance, marked by rituals, prayers, and observances. The belief that celestial bodies influence human lives is deeply rooted in Indian culture, and eclipses are seen as pivotal moments for introspection, purification, and spiritual growth. Many temples across India close their doors during a solar eclipse, as it is believed that the negative energy released during the eclipse can contaminate the sacred spaces.

The Science Behind Solar Eclipses

From a scientific standpoint, a Surya Grahan occurs when the Moon comes between the Earth and the Sun, casting a shadow on the Earth’s surface. There are three types of solar eclipses: total, partial, and annular. During a total solar eclipse, the Moon completely covers the Sun, plunging the area into darkness for a few minutes. A partial solar eclipse occurs when the Moon only partially covers the Sun, creating a mesmerizing crescent shape. An annular solar eclipse happens when the Moon is at its farthest point from Earth, appearing smaller and leaving a ring of the Sun’s light visible around its edges.

Safety Precautions for Viewing Surya Grahan

While observing a Surya Grahan can be a wondrous experience, it is crucial to take precautions to protect your eyes during this celestial event. Looking directly at the Sun, even during an eclipse, can cause severe eye damage or even blindness. Specialized solar filters, such as eclipse glasses or telescope filters, are essential for safe viewing. Alternatively, you can create a pinhole projector to indirectly view the eclipse without risking eye injury. It is important to educate children and young adults about the dangers of looking at the Sun during an eclipse and to supervise their viewing activities.
